Prevalence Of Keratoconus Among Patients With Thyroid Gland Dysfunction
trial testing no intervention in Keratoconus in Thyroid Gland Dysfunction in 400 participants. Completed in 15 March 2022.

Who can join
Adults 18 to 70, any sex, with Keratoconus in Thyroid Gland Dysfunction. Patients with the condition only — healthy volunteers not accepted.
Sponsor's own description
Hormonal imbalances are likely to affect the corneal metabolism and may be also associated with Keratoconus. Among the various endocrinologic dysfunctions assumed so far, thyroid gland dysfunction (TGD) (hypo- or hyperthyroidism; comprised as TGD) is frequently associated with eye diseases such as Graves disease
